That's the main reason I went with OEM. alignment was a breeze and the driving dynamics is trouble free after. I dont like bushings only then because they are not avail and the "dissection" of the suspension is extensive just to remove and replace those damn things. Mahirap din i-align kasi yung mga replacement bushings (although not all).. removal & reassembly is also expensive. Kaya kahit mas mahal OEM kung tatagal naman >5 years with regular use e ok na....
